Labneh (Lebanese Cream Cheese)

This is the Lebanese version of cream cheese, a lot tastier and lower in calories. Serve on a plate, sprinkled with olive oil, olives, tomatoes, cucumbers and mint. Or simply spread it like cream cheese on pita bread.

Prep Time:
5 mins
Total Time:
5 mins
Yield:
2 pounds
Servings:
32

Ingredients

  • 16 cups plain yogurt
  • 1 teaspoon salt, or to taste
  • ¼ cup olive oil

Directions

Step 1
Line a large colander with a cheesecloth. Stir salt into the yogurt, and pour the yogurt into the cheesecloth. Set the colander in the sink or bowl to catch the liquid that drains off. Leave to drain for 24 hours.

Step 2
After draining for the 24 hours, transfer the resulting cheese to a bowl. Stir in the olive oil. Store in a covered container in the refrigerator.
